Former Umbria President Marini convicted for health tenders.

Summary by Quotidiano Nazionale
Former Umbria Region President Catiuscia Marini, PD, has been sentenced to two years in prison by the Perugia court for two of the contested episodes in the trial for the alleged manipulation of tenders issued by the hospital company and the USL 1. Acquitted of the charge of "not having committed the crime" for the alleged association for criminal purposes.
